Output 7a58f4d46966fd21a8e204e82c1f61937d7aa35ec775b6a0aefa26b7544116a3:6

value
582615682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f88b2fee1d693638b5f9e7e12c2f3b577c8837 OP_EQUAL
address
MBTDeqbtnVQ9e37mjphYkv6dPDpN7Eo9qm
transaction
7a58f4d46966fd21a8e204e82c1f61937d7aa35ec775b6a0aefa26b7544116a3
spent
true